Kirsten warned by BCCI over comments

Published September 5, 2008

NEW DELHI, Sept 4: BCCI secretary Niranjan Shah reacted to Team India coach Gary Kirsten’s comments on India’s Test captaincy asking him to stay away from media, according to Times Now.

Shah also said that it is selectors’ job to decide about the captaincy issue.

Earlier on Tuesday, Mahendra Singh Dhoni’s leadership qualities got a thumbs up from India’s cricket coach Gary Kirsten who said the ODI skipper was now ready to take over the Test captaincy from Anil Kumble.—Agencies
